Distribution: It is native to the coastline of western North America from Alaska to Baja, California, where it is a common kelp of the intertidal zone. 

Description: Inspired by the natural beauty of Egregia menziesii—commonly known as Feather Boa Kelp—this synthetic replica mimics the flowing, strap-like fronds and feather-like blades of the real plant. Native to the cold, nutrient-rich waters of the North Pacific, this large brown alga is a key component of kelp forest ecosystems along the Pacific coastline.
